It can be extremely hard to figure out which sort of flooring is right for your home. To pick the ideal flooring you need to think about the way the room will be used. Ceramic tile is a flexible flooring which can work well in several different rooms. Though ceramic frequently costs more than some other flooring for many the great looks and excellent performance is worth the additional money.
Bogs and kitchens are both good places to install ceramic flooring. Both these rooms see plenty of moisture which can damage other sorts of flooring. Ceramic tile also performs well with the temperature modifications that will regularly be found in the kitchen. Ceramic tile is also a brilliant option for beach houses as it can give excellent performance even in the damp sea air.
It’s also a good choice in the humidity and heat seen in coastal parts of the country. Many folks are concerned about installing ceramic tile in areas where the temperatures come down in the winter months. Your ceramic tiles will look good and keep your feet warm if you just add some throw rugs for extra warmth. These rugs can add color and style as well as warmth to the space.
It’s not hard at all to maintain and clean ceramic tiles. If you live in a wet area you may occasionally need to get rid of mold employing a special cleaning solution available at most home centers. By employing the right cleaning product you can keep your tile floors looking superb for the life of your house. They will require regular maintenance with a vacuum and mop.
While they’re incredibly durable you will not need to use oppressive cleaners which can cause damage to the tiles. Proper installation is a vital component of keeping your tiles looking great for a number of years. Hiring cheap installers without proper experience will finish up costing you more money in the future.
